Solving Banking Disputes

Although banks usually provide efficient services, they may sometimes commit transactional errors that can have a negative affect on your bank balance. If you suspect that there has been a mistake, you need to take it up with your bank as soon as possible. However, following certain standard procedures will help you to resolve the problem, without affecting your existing relationship with the bank.

Banking disputes can arise due to various reasons, which are mostly technical in nature, and can usually be settled amicably. For example, an installment payment could be wrongly deducted from your account before the due date, or the bank incorrectly charging you a penalty fee, or incorrect balance calculations, and the like. Sometimes disputes may also occur due to human error by the bank employees. Disputes like these can be settled agreeably by following the procedures given below:

Communicate In Writing

To settle a banking dispute, you first need to write a formal letter to your bank, explaining the basic problem, and the reasons why you think it has occurred. Providing the necessary documents to support your point of view will add to the veracity of your claim. This letter will allow bank officials to understand your case, and help them to conduct the necessary checks on related bank records or documents. It will also form the basis for future deliberations with your bank.

Read The Fine Print

Before making a claim of dispute with your bank, you need to go through all their business policies, and all the information given in fine print. When disputes are made, it is often discovered that banks are within their rights, and are following the correct procedures. By going through the fine print, you can ensure that you have proper rights to dispute your case.

Avoid Aggressive Behavior

Even if you have the legal rights to dispute your case, an aggressive stance will not solve your problem. Most errors are technical and unintentional, and bank officials will most likely ignore you if you get belligerent with them. Remaining calm usually results in resolving problems far more smoothly.

Meet Bank Officials In Person

Although letters can clear up most banking discrepancies, certain disputes may require you to personally meet the bank manager, or some other bank representatives. Communicating with bank officials in person will allow you to present your case in a better way, while also enabling them to understand the full extent of your problem.

You need to come to terms with the possibility that your case may not be worked out forthwith, because banks will most likely give priority to their daily working requirements. However, it is also true that banks value their customers, and will do everything possible to clear up their problems. Persevering with your claims of dispute until you get your problem resolved is advisable. Moreover, if you are not satisfied with the bank’s response even after a lot of negotiations, you can seek advice from financial advisors, or companies that settle banking disputes. You can rest assured that as long as you have the documents to support your claim, you will get your dispute settled in your favor, though it may take some time.

Chip N Pin Good or Bad

More and more we are becoming a cashless society. Almost every purchase we make now days is on the card whether that is a credit card or a debit card. To try to limit credit and debit card fraud, the powers that be introduced Chip n pin so that you no longer sign for your purchase, you just enter your secret pin number and away you go. Best keep it safe from prying eyes though there are both advantages and disadvantages to the use of Chip n pin and this article will explore some of them.

Advantages

The chip n pin prevents anyone from copying your signature. Before chip n pin, if you went into a restaurant, your card was often taken away from you and details entered out of your sight only to be returned for a signature. This did result in a number of frauds perpetrated on customers who paid their bill in this way. With the arrival of chip n pin, the card remains with the customer and there is no signature needed. It also makes it harder for a thief to use your card unless they have your personal pin number. Certainly, both credit and debit card fraud has been reduced since the introduction of chip and pin.

Disadvantages

While credit and debit card fraud has gone down with chip and pin, at the same time, cashpoint fraud has gone up. They use hidden cameras sometimes so that they can see which keys are pressed for the pin. They sometimes place an invisible strip where the card is entered and commit fraud that way. The advent of chip and pin has also generated a rise in phishing, this is where fraudsters get hold of your email address and send out emails claiming to be from a bank and asking for you to click and check your account details. Once a person clicks on the link, they are redirected to a fraudulent site, If they then give out their account details, they are in danger of having their bank account raided.

Conclusion

In some respects, the introduction of chip and pin does make life a bit less complicated and certain forms of credit and debit card fraud have decreased. On the other hand, this has encouraged fraudsters to become ever more creative in designing ways to illegally access other people’s money. While we are constantly warned about keeping our details secret and safely disposing of letters from the bank and credit card statements, people are still being defrauded of their money. These days, if you don’t have a bank account, a lot of doors are no longer open to you buying over the internet or having a mobile phone contract, for example. Chip and pin may not be a hundred percent secure, but if we take precautions in other areas, our money is probably safer than it was before the introduction of this way of using your cards.

The Check Clearance Process from a Business Perspective

Business checks are written everyday at almost every place of business. At age 18, anyone with the adequate amount of money can open a checking account of his or her own.

One aspect of checking account functions that many account owners are not familiar with the processing of their checks after they have been written. When shopping, the customer many times thinks to his or herself whether he or she should pay cash, charge it, or pay for the purchase with a check. He or she may ponder this question in their mind all the way to the check out counter.

When the customer makes the decision to pay for the merchandise with a check, a long process is started. This process begins when the check is handed over to the cashier. Once all information has been properly placed on the check the cashier then will normally ask for two things, a home phone number and a driver’s license number.

Once all of the necessary information has been placed on the check by both the cashier and the customer the check is scanned in the automatic check reader. This check reader recognizes the customers account number, A.B.A. number (or routing number), as well as the check number.

The computer system can then recognize the specific account and check to make sure that there are no returned checks on that account. Once the check is approved, it is then printed or endorsed on the back with all proper information for deposits, including the amount of the purchase, cash back received (if applicable), store location number, date, time, cashier number, and the customer’s account number.

The cashier then stores the check in a locked box until it is time for them to go home. All checks are then added together to make sure none are missing and to make sure the cashier put all checks in for the correct amount. All checks received in the office at the end of the day are totaled together and deposited into the bank account.

When the person responsible goes to the bank and makes the deposit for the business, he or she hands a large number of checks to the bank teller. The teller will then verify the amount of the deposit to the total amount of the checks.

After the deposit has been verified and all numbers are correct, the teller will then run the checks through the proof machine to be verified again. The proof machine also encodes the amount on the bottom right hand corner of the check. When all of the work has been ran through the proof machine it is then sorted by an automatic sorter that sorts the checks by their routing numbers.

After the checks have been sorted they are sent to the bank that they have been drawn on. Once the checks arrive at the banks they are drawn on, they are then sorted by their account numbers. As these checks are being sorted they are posted to the account automatically. The checks then, in account number order are placed in a safe filing area so they will not be lost until the bank statements are sent to the account owners.

The check or a copy of the check is then sent to the account owner in the mail with his or her statement. In the case that a copy of the check is sent to the owner the check is kept in a safe place until it can be properly destroyed.

This is only one example of the way a check is cleared through a certain business. Although, the basic concept of check clearing is the same, each individual company may go through its own processing procedure before depositing the check to the bank. Most banks handle their business checks in approximately the same manner.

Unsecured Loans Your Solution to an Improved Credit Score

A bad credit score used to make it impossible for individuals and families to borrow money for home and car financing. Today, there are several companies which not only give individuals with bad credit unsecured loans but actually cater to people who have extremely low credit scores.

If you are interested in an unsecured loan there are a number of issues to explore before applying. The first and most important step is knowing how bad your credit score is. The easiest way to get your credit score is to go to a credit agency. However, there are banks and mortgage companies which offer their customers a free yearly credit report – all you have to do is ask.

The interest rates offered to you can be effected by bad credit scores or no credit at all. There are many websites which offer an instant credit report for a small fee. Another reason to check your credit score is it may not be as bad as you think it is. Often credit ratings are simply misunderstood by individuals.

In process of receiving your credit score be sure to check your credit report for improper information. Credit reports can be the first indication of credit card fraud or identity theft. Both of which can leave individuals and their families emotionally and financially devastated.

Once you have your credit score you can use any one of the online loan evaluators. These calculators will allow you to figure out how much money you can borrow and the interest rates that are available to you. It is important to make an informed decision when picking a loan provider. While television advertisements and newspaper ads can be tempting, it is better to research a number of established and reputable loan organizations.

Many “get money now” companies have hidden costs and penalties which consumers are not aware of until after they sign the papers. Looking around for loan companies online is a great way to save money and time. Many lenders have online applications which can be filled out for free. Once you have made your list of possible lenders it is a good to have specific criteria for choosing your loan company.

Besides choosing a company that has a good business reputation choose one that is going to offer you the best deal. This does not always mean the lowest interest rate. Other things to consider are the time period for repayment, penalties if you pay the loan off to quickly, what are the late fees, is the interest rate variable or fixed, and what is the APR.

Unsecured loans usually let an individual borrow less than a secured loan. The interest rate is usually higher for an unsecured loan.

One of the benefits of going with an unsecured loan is it is usually approved quicker which means you get the money faster. This is because secured loans need property to secure it. Property must first be evaluated to see how much it is worth.

Unsecured loans are a great way for individuals who do suffer from bad credit to improve their credit rating, consolidate debt, take vacation, or cover unexpected medical expenses.
